SplashSave is a social enterprise that works alongside Water Safety New Zealand and swimming New Zealand to deliver a whanau led water safety safety program.
We believe parents teaching their own Tamariki the basics of swimming and water safety will allow future generations to enjoy New Zealand’s playground safely and lower the horrific drowning toll in this country.
20% of all proceeds go directly to higher risk drowning groups including free education to enable communities to teach themselves swimming and water safety skills.
All funds raised will assist the charitable purpose towards reaching the goal of every New Zealander has the opportunity to learn to swim to survive.
